 Clicklist: LA gets ranked

>> The new College Sustainability Report Card’s now out! My alma mater University of Southern California gets a C+; its rival UCLA gets a B-. Above’s the side by side comparison. (via grist)

>> LA’s not faring too well on city rankings — the 2008 SustainLane U.S. City Rankings and the Forbes’ list of the nation’s most stressful metro areas to be exact. Reasons: poor air quality, roadway congestion, sprawl, housing affordability, unemployment, and gas prices.

>> Just in time for Green Jobs Now: LA officials want to build a green industrial park — aka CleanTech Manufacturing Center — in downtown LA “to create jobs with a cluster of environmentally sustainable companies on a former brownfield site.”
